Again, armed herdsmen attack Benue community, kill barbing salon operator, displace scores.

Published

on

Herdsmen

From Attah Ede, Makurdi 

Suspected armed herdsmen have again,  launched a fresh attack on Rijo community, Ogege Council Ward of Ado Local Government Area, LGA, of Benue state, killing one barbing salon operator identified as Thomas Edeh and leaving several others displaced.

The attack still left many people missing and their whereabout unknown.

It was gathered that the armed marauders attacked the community located six  kilometres Igumale town, headquarters of  Ado LGA, Tuesday at about 7:10pm,

It was further learnt that the victim, an indigene of Effium community in Ebonyi State but was residing at Rijo community and operating Barbing business in the popular Idokpo Garri market.

A community leader and former leader of Ado legislative council, who hailed from the axis told journalists on phone in Makurdi, on Wednesday  on condition of anonymity, that the victim was also a great farmer and was attacked and shot dead by the armed Fulani herdsmen right in his farm.

“It’s very unfortunate, Fulani has been stealing his yams, he has persistently warned them to stop, but the best Fulani can do is to eliminate him.

“This young man was attacked and shot dead in his farm at Rijo, Ogege Ward, Utonkon District, Ado Local Government Area of Benue State on Tuesday, 4th November 2025, by Fulani herder.

“Don’t we, as a nation, need security assistance at this stage of our history in Nigeria?, he questioned.

“Now, our people can no longer go to farm or market. Children are afraid of going to school, even to ride on motorcycles or bicycles to work at the  council secretariat in Igumale, is very risky because of the fear of unknown.

Iam calling on government at all levels to do something about this security issues. More security personnel should be deploy to Ado particularly in Rijo community to avert further attacks, he said.

Efforts to get the reaction of the Ado Council chairman, Mr. Sunday Oche proved abortive as his phone number couldn’t connect as at the time of filing this report.

But when contacted, the Benue State Command Police Public Relations Officer (PPRO) DSP Udeme Edet confirmed the incidence, saying that the command has commenced investigation to unravel the mystery behind the attack and killing of victim.

“The command is aware of the Incident and the commissioner of police has directed immediate investigation of the Incident”, she said.

Meanwhile, the Deputy Speaker of the Benue State House of Assembly, Chief Mrs. Lami Danladi Ogenyi, on Wednesday, condemned the attack  on Rijo community by suspected Fulani  herdsmen resulting to the death of one person.

She however called on security agencies in Ado Local Government Area to intensify efforts in protecting the lives and property of residents.

Chief Mrs. Ogenyi who is representing Ado State Constituency at the state house of assembly, explained that she  was  completely saddened by the report of a suspected herdsmen attack on Rijo Community in Ogege Council Ward of Ado LGA on Tuesday, November 4, 2025, during which one person was reportedly shot dead while working on his farm.

While condemning the attack in strong terms, the  state lawmaker described the  attack as “a cruel and unprovoked act against innocent citizens going about their lawful activities.”

The deputy speaker in a statement by her chief press secretary, Agbaji Samuel Atsonwu, urged security operatives to urgently conduct a thorough investigation into the incident and ensure that those responsible are brought to justice. 

The statement further charged security agencies to remain vigilant and proactive to prevent a recurrence of such attacks in the area.

While expressing her deepest condolences to the family of the deceased, Chief  Ogenyi prayed God to grant them the strength to bear this painful loss.
